What is the best time to stay in a family-friendly hotel in Fort William?
If you want to visit when crowds are smaller, head here in January. You could snag some good deals on family-friendly hotels in Fort William around that time. The warmest weather is in July, with temperatures ranging from 46ºF (8ºC) to 61ºF (16ºC). It's coolest in January, averaging between 32ºF (0ºC) and 37ºF (3ºC).
